Goldenseal ST

Goldenseal (*Hydrastis canadensis*) is a powerful herb native to North America, known for its antimicrobial, anti-inflammatory, and immune-supporting properties. Its active compounds, particularly berberine, hydrastine, and canadine, make it highly effective against bacterial, viral, and fungal infections. Goldenseal is commonly used to treat respiratory and digestive infections, such as colds, sinusitis, and gastroenteritis, as it helps reduce inflammation and supports the body’s natural defenses. Its astringent properties also make it beneficial for soothing mucous membranes, reducing irritation in the throat, sinuses, and gastrointestinal tract.

Beyond infection management, goldenseal is valued for its role in promoting skin health and healing wounds. It is often applied topically to treat minor cuts, abrasions, and skin conditions like eczema or acne due to its antibacterial and anti-inflammatory effects. Additionally, goldenseal may support liver health and improve digestion by stimulating bile production. While it is a versatile remedy, caution is advised, as prolonged use can deplete beneficial gut flora, and it should be avoided during pregnancy. Its wide range of uses in traditional and modern herbal medicine underscores goldenseal’s reputation as a natural healer.
